Upon completion of this course, the Learner should be able to:
- Explain the material and resource efficiency of engineered wood products (EWPs) and discuss why they represent the future of structural wood products.
- Discuss the life cycle assessment rankings of wood and discern how and why EWPs can help meet our construction needs into the 21st century.
- Compare laminated strand lumber (LSL) to its traditional and other structural composite lumber counterparts in beam and header, wall framing, stair stringer, and rim board applications, including criteria such as performance capabilities, cost effectiveness, value engineering, and ease of installation.
- Explain the manufacturing process of LSL and discuss the process in terms of its energy efficiency and utilization of wood.
- Discuss the features and benefits of using LSL, and identify how the product is used as a whole house structural framing member.
